A cross-platform application for aggregating and visualising real-time Aurora Australis forecast data.

Predicting the weather on Earth is still not an exact science, and this becomes more evident when we try to go beyond our own atmosphere - a limitation all "Aurora Chasers" must begrudgingly accept.

With this in mind; this project sets out with the intent to provide tools to identify when there is a substantially elevated probability of seeing an Aurora.

As any predictive model is only as good as the underlying data, we will focus on identifying and communicating the things we know with a reasonable degree of confidence.

Current features

####Charts/Data

  • Real-time solar wind data feeds from ACE/DSCOVR satelites
  • Collection of live, and forecast charts from NOAA, BOM etc. (TAS magnetometers, 6hr PLASMAG etc.)
  • Generate animations of Ovation and CME forecasts etc *(prrof of concept only, planned refactor)
  • UTC and local time display *(local time fixed to TAS, we should set by location)

####Maps

  • Basemaps (topo, street, satellite)
  • Light pollution map (2015)
  • Dynamic South Pole (data till 2020)
  • Live ISS tracker
  • Interactive viewing locations map

####Weather

  • Widget to show weather based on location
  • Widget to show moon phase info based on location
  • Animated satellite imagery map from BOM (national cloud cover)
  • Cressy Cam Video feed

Deployment notes

Currently deployed to AWS EC2 instance using Meteor Up.
Some basic starter notes here: http://sergelobatch.com/slog/2015/4/10/using-mup/

With AWS and mup.json configured:

$ mup setup 
$ mup deploy

If you get deployment errors, check the logs $ mup logs -f
